CN-122009948-A - Car body skirt limit device and car body lifting appliance
Abstract
The invention discloses a vehicle body skirt limit device and a vehicle body lifting appliance, which comprise two groups of side clamping limit structures, wherein the side clamping surfaces of the side clamping limit structures are in soft contact with a plurality of cushion bags along the vehicle body skirt, one side of each side clamping belt, which is far away from the vehicle body, is provided with a liquid injection pipe group communicated with the cushion bags, one end of each side clamping belt is in telescopic reset through a rolling rod in a containing box, a liquid storage box and a liquid return plate connected with a hydraulic spring are also arranged in the containing box and are used for buffering and storing hydraulic oil, the vehicle body lifting appliance comprises a back swing structure, a piston body of a driving liquid chamber in an outer pipe body of the vehicle body is matched with a spiral groove through limiting convex points, the gravity of the vehicle body drives the piston body to rotate upwards during lifting so as to realize automatic return of the vehicle body, an angle sensor is arranged in the limiting rod, and is linked with an electric push rod and a supporting frame, so that the piston body movement section and a rotation angle are accurately matched.

Car body skirt limit device and car body lifting appliance Technical Field The invention relates to the technical field of hoisting equipment, in particular to a vehicle body skirt limit device and a vehicle body lifting appliance. Background Under the background of deep popularization of global energy transformation and environmental protection concepts, the new energy vehicle becomes the core direction of upgrading of the automobile industry by virtue of the core advantages of zero emission and low energy consumption, the market permeability is continuously improved, higher requirements are provided for the comprehensive performance of a vehicle body structure, the skirt edge of the vehicle body serves as a key component part of the side surface of the vehicle body, the design and the function adaptation of the skirt edge are directly related to the overall performance of the new energy vehicle, the core development requirements of light weight and aerodynamic optimization of the whole vehicle are met, the boosting endurance capability is improved, the overall and streamline trial and aesthetic requirements of a user on the appearance of the vehicle body are met, meanwhile, the layout characteristics of the new energy vehicle chassis are required to be adapted, the compliance protection and the installation support are provided for core components such as a battery pack and a motor, the important design links for balancing the performance, the appearance and the practicability of the vehicle are become, and the importance of the vehicle is increasingly significant in the integrated design of the whole vehicle along with the iterative upgrading of the new energy vehicle technology. However, in the whole-vehicle lifting operation of the conventional new energy automobile, after the skirt edge of the automobile body is bound by the binding belt, surface abrasion is easy to occur in the moving process, the abrasion not only can damage the integrity of the appearance of the automobile body and influence the attractiveness of the automobile, but also can cause the coating of the skirt edge to fall off and the structure to be damaged, thereby increasing the maintenance cost of the automobile and the economic loss of the lifting operation and bringing unnecessary trouble to users. Therefore, a vehicle body skirt limit device and a vehicle body lifting appliance are provided. Disclosure of Invention The invention aims to provide a vehicle body skirt limit device and a vehicle body lifting appliance, which are used for solving the problem of skirt surface abrasion during lifting of a new energy vehicle. In order to achieve the above purpose, the invention provides a vehicle body skirt limit device, comprising: the side clamp limiting structures are arranged in a group, and are attached and bound at skirt edges at two sides of the lifting car during lifting; The side clamp limiting structure comprises a side clamp belt, a plurality of cushion bags are integrally arranged on the surface of the side clamp belt along the surface of the skirt edge of the vehicle body in a soft contact manner from top to bottom, and a liquid injection pipe group is arranged on the side surface far away from the vehicle body and communicated with the cushion bags. Preferably, the side clamp limiting structure further comprises a hanging beam, the length of the hanging beam is greater than or equal to the length of a lifted vehicle, a plurality of hanging lugs are integrally welded on the upper surface and the lower surface, the hanging lugs on the upper side and the lower side are respectively connected and bound with hanging lugs on the surface of the backswing structure through steel wire ropes in an interpenetration mode, and after the binding of the binding belt on the hub, the side clamping belt is integrally stitched on one side of the binding belt close to the skirt edge. Preferably, one end of the side strap is wound and fixed in a containing chamber corresponding to the side strap arranged on the same side in the containing chamber, a winding rolling rod which is similar to a tape measure and is reset after twisting is arranged in the containing chamber, the main body of the containing chamber protrudes downwards from the side strap, a liquid storage chamber is arranged in the protruding portion, at least one hydraulic spring is matched below the liquid storage chamber, and a liquid return plate is elastically connected with the liquid storage chamber, wherein an interface of the containing chamber matched bottom surface and the liquid storage chamber is communicated with a liquid injection pipe set through a pipeline, and the liquid injection pipe set consists of a plurality of pipelines communicated with a soft cushion bag and a main pipeline for rectifying the pipelines.
